Assetize Outputs

Assetizing outputs allows you to create an Asset Collection from the outputs of a previous Experiment, Simulation, Workitem and other Asset Collections. In Addition, you can create assets from multiple items of these type. For examples, 3 simulations and an Asset Collection, or an experiment and a workItem. Assetize Outputs is implemented as a workitem that depends on other items to complete before running.

AssetizeOutputs using glob patterns to select or deselect files. See https://docs.python.org/3/library/glob.html for details on glob patterns. The default configuration is set to Assetize all outputs, “**” pattern, and exclude the “StdOut.txt”, “StdErr.txt”, and “WorkOrder.json” files.

You can see a list of files that will be assetized without assetizing them by using the dry_run parameter. The file list will be in the output of the work item.
